ForEachEnumeratorInfos.GetEnumerator Метод
Определение
Важно!
Некоторые сведения относятся к предварительной версии продукта, в которую до выпуска могут быть внесены существенные изменения. Майкрософт не предоставляет никаких гарантий, явных или подразумеваемых, относительно приведенных здесь сведений.
Возвращает ForEachEnumeratorInfosEnumerator для прохода по коллекции ForEachEnumeratorInfos.
public:
Microsoft::SqlServer::Dts::Runtime::ForEachEnumeratorInfosEnumerator ^ GetEnumerator();
public Microsoft.SqlServer.Dts.Runtime.ForEachEnumeratorInfosEnumerator GetEnumerator ();
override this.GetEnumerator : unit -> Microsoft.SqlServer.Dts.Runtime.ForEachEnumeratorInfosEnumerator
Public Function GetEnumerator () As ForEachEnumeratorInfosEnumerator
Возвращаемое значение
Перечислитель ForEachEnumeratorInfosEnumerator.
Примеры
В следующем примере кода используется GetEnumerator для создания .ForEachEnumeratorInfosEnumerator
using System;
using System.Collections;
using System.Collections.Generic;
using System.Text;
using Microsoft.SqlServer.Dts.Runtime;
using Microsoft.SqlServer.Dts.Runtime.Enumerators.Item;
namespace ForEachEnums
{
class Program
{
static void Main(string[] args)
{
Application app = new Application();
ForEachEnumeratorInfos feInfos = app.ForEachEnumeratorInfos;
//Create the Enumerator.
ForEachEnumeratorInfosEnumerator myEnumerator = feInfos.GetEnumerator();
Console.WriteLine("The collection contains the following values:");
int i = 0;
while ((myEnumerator.MoveNext()) && (myEnumerator.Current != null))
Console.WriteLine("[{0}] {1}", i++, myEnumerator.Current.Name);
}
}
}
Образец вывода:
Коллекция содержит следующие значения:
[0] Для каждого перечислителя файлов
[1] Для каждого перечислителя элементов
[2] Для каждого перечислителя ADO
[3] Для каждого перечислителя набора строк схемы ADO.NET
[4] Для каждого из перечислителя переменных
[5] Для каждого перечислителя NodeList
[6] Для каждого перечислителя объектов SMO